(Disclaimer: I work for a Web Security Company, so I'm biased).

In my opinion, the Cisco router is not suited for such tasks. Why? Because the Internet is ever changing, and what is a "phone-home" type site today is gone tomorrow, and ever changing. Your best bet is to do a Web Proxy and proxy that stuff before going over the link.

Get yourself a proxy that works with WCCP, and configure WCCP on your Cisco router to re-direct the appropriate web traffic over to the proxy (this way, you don't have to alter any desktops). Then use a URL filtering database on the proxy to block the appropriate category (say, all Malware sites, or all Phone-home type sites).
